class TransitionLevel extends Object
| Modifier and Type | Field and Description |
|---|---|
private char |
currentChar |
private boolean |
isNextTransitionLevelPassed |
private dk.brics.automaton.State |
state |
private int |
transitionIndex |
| Constructor and Description |
|---|
TransitionLevel(dk.brics.automaton.State state) |
| Modifier and Type | Method and Description |
|---|---|
char |
getCurrentChar() |
dk.brics.automaton.Transition |
getCurrentTransition() |
char |
getMaxCharInCurrentTransition() |
dk.brics.automaton.State |
getState() |
dk.brics.automaton.Transition |
getTransition(int index) |
int |
getTransitionIndex() |
boolean |
hasCharacterTransition() |
private boolean |
hasMoreTransitions() |
boolean |
hasNextTransitionLevel() |
boolean |
jumpToNextTransition()
return true if we succeed to jump to the next transition, false if there
is no more transition .
|
TransitionLevel |
nextTransitionLevel() |
void |
setCurrentChar(char currentChar) |
void |
setState(dk.brics.automaton.State state) |
void |
setTransitionIndex(int transitionIndex) |
private dk.brics.automaton.State state
private int transitionIndex
private boolean isNextTransitionLevelPassed
private char currentChar
public boolean hasCharacterTransition()
private boolean hasMoreTransitions()
public boolean jumpToNextTransition()
public boolean hasNextTransitionLevel()
public TransitionLevel nextTransitionLevel()
public dk.brics.automaton.Transition getTransition(int index)
public dk.brics.automaton.Transition getCurrentTransition()
public char getMaxCharInCurrentTransition()
public char getCurrentChar()
public void setCurrentChar(char currentChar)
public int getTransitionIndex()
public void setTransitionIndex(int transitionIndex)
public dk.brics.automaton.State getState()
public void setState(dk.brics.automaton.State state)
Copyright © 2015. All Rights Reserved.